About this property

Very Private home, walk to town, hike trails, cyclist dream location

Walls of glass look out to beautiful heritage Oaks, birds, squirrels and the surrounding canyons from the large open and beautiful Great-room. The home has an old world charm with its wrought iron gate, stone walls, gardens and patios you might just feel like you are in the south of France or Italy! Yet this is a modern and well appointed elegant home/ mini estate, it is all yours to enjoy relax and restore. Stroll to town and enjoy all that lively Fairfax offers with it’s many cafes, restaurants, music venues, farmers market, Good Earth or hike the many trails of Mt. Tam and Deer Park right from your door or spend the day at one of it’s many lakes, or near by beaches, this is the good life! Sleep peacefully while listening to the crickets in the large bedroom with its pillow top king size bed, Restoration Hardware furniture and walk-in closet. Soak in the oversize tub in the beautiful garden windowed bathroom. Cooks will love the chef’s kitchen. Winters are gentle here in Marin, rains turn the hills green while most of the country is covered in snow. Guest are warmed by the huge wood burning fireplace, the beauty of Mt Tam is now filled with waterfalls. The magic continues! About the area

Fairfax

Located in Fairfax, this holiday home is near theme parks and by the sea. Muir Woods National Monument is a notable landmark, and the area's natural beauty can be seen at San Francisco Bay and Point Reyes National Seashore. Falkirk Cultural Center and Book Passage are also worth visiting. Kayaking and sailing offer great chances to get out on the surrounding water, or you can seek out an adventure with mountain biking and hiking/biking trails nearby.
